¿Adónde van realmente tus prompts cuando usas un asistente de código con IA?
La huella invisible de los asistentes de IA para programar
Cuando conectas tu asistente de IA favorito para avanzar en un proyecto, algo ocurre sin que lo veas. Tu código se fragmenta en tokens. La estructura de tu proyecto se analiza. Las llamadas a APIs se registran. Y en algún servidor remoto, se procesan y almacenan detalles de cómo trabajas.
Lo más incómodo es que pocos desarrolladores saben realmente qué información se está enviando.
El problema de la confianza en el desarrollo actual
Hemos pasado de usar compiladores locales e IDEs instalados en máquinas propias a depender casi por completo de servicios en la nube. Los asistentes de IA han acelerado este cambio. Ofrecen velocidad y productividad, pero a cambio crean un flujo de datos que casi nadie entiende del todo.
Al depurar una función o escribir nueva lógica, es posible que estés:
- Subiendo fragmentos de código propietario a servidores externos
- Compartiendo claves de API o tokens de autenticación
- Exponiendo configuraciones sensibles del proyecto
- Generando registros permanentes de decisiones internas
- Alimentando modelos de IA con tu propiedad intelectual
No se trata de que estas herramientas actúen de forma maliciosa. El problema está en la fe que depositas en ellas sin tener información suficiente ni mecanismos para controlar lo que ocurre.
Por qué esto puede afectarte más que imaginas
Las consecuencias de seguridad son claras. 但 hay riesgos más sutiles:
Erosión de ventaja competitiva: tus decisiones arquitectónicas, técnicas de optimización y lógica de negocio pueden estar entrenando modelos que también usan tus competidores. Cuando todos trabajan con los mismos agentes y datos, se pierde diferencia.
Complicaciones en cumplimiento normativo: si tu trabajo involucra datos de pacientes, finanzas o información personal que cae bajo regulaciones como GDPR, HIPAA o SOC 2, enviar esos datos a asistentes en la nube puede tener consecuencias legales que no has pensado.
Riesgos en la cadena de suministro: si tu agente de IA se compromete, la información que ha visto cada vez puede convertirse en un arma para los atacantes.
Dependencia difícil de romper: a medida